Several years ago b would have been the answer to your first question. However, today, it's mostly older people who still have land lines and are listed in the phone book. (I don't even think I've gotten a phone book in the last couple of years.) None of your answers would produce random results.
Your second answer is correct.

a. It is not clear if Mr. Kent's sample of 54 students is a random sample. A random sample would be selected in such a way that every student in the school has an equal chance of being included in the sample. Without more information about how Mr. Kent selected the 54 students, it is not possible to determine if this is a random sample or not.
b. The survey question used by Mr. Kent is biased because it includes the phrase "lengthy school day." This phrase suggests that the current length of the school day is a problem or burden, which could influence respondents to favor a shorter day. A more neutral question would ask something like "Do you think the school day should be shortened?"
c. Of the 54 responses, 3 were "no." To find the percent of responses that were "no," we can use the formula:
no responses / total responses * 100%
In this case, we have:
3 / 54 * 100% = 5.6%
So 5.6% of the responses were "no."
